Solution for 28x^2+44x= equation:


Simplifying
28x2 + 44x = 0

Reorder the terms:
44x + 28x2 = 0

Solving
44x + 28x2 = 0

Solving for variable 'x'.

Factor out the Greatest Common Factor (GCF), '4x'.
4x(11 + 7x) = 0

Ignore the factor 4.

Subproblem 1

Set the factor 'x'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ying x = 0 Solving x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Simplifying x = 0

Subproblem 2

Set the factor '(11 + 7x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 11 + 7x = 0 Solving 11 + 7x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-11' to each side of the equation. 11 + -11 + 7x = 0 + -11 Combine like terms: 11 + -11 = 0 0 + 7x = 0 + -11 7x = 0 + -11 Combine like terms: 0 + -11 = -11 7x = -11 Divide each side by '7'. x = -1.571428571 Simplifying x = -1.571428571

Solution

x = {0, -1.571428571}
